About this experience
Hop on a bike and explore Paris in the most efficient and eco-friendly way. Learn to navigate the city and see the Eiffel Tower, Les Invalides, and Arc de Triomphe. Extended options: see more sights such as the Notre-Dame Cathedral, Louvre, and many more. Choose one of our excellent tour options tailored to your needs and interests: 2-hour: Basic Old Town Cycling Route Enjoy a short cycling route and see Old Town highlights such as the Eiffel Tower, Champ de Mars, Les Invalides, and Arc de Triomphe. 4-hour: Extended Old Town Cycling Route Join this tour to see more Old Town highlights, such as the Eiffel Tower, Les Invalides, Louvre, Palais Garnier, Grand Palais, Arc de Triomphe and more. 6-hour: Full Old Town Cycling Route Choose this tour to get to know Paris like a local and see the Eiffel Tower, Luxembourg Gardens, Panthéon, Notre Dame Cathedral, Hôtel de Ville, Louvre, Palais Garnier, Arc de Triomphe.

What you'll see and do
Meet your guide In front of the Bank of China, 23 Avenue de la Grande Armée, 75116 Paris, France
10 minutes here
Palais de Chaillot
You will hop on a bike and cycle along the Avenue Kléber to Place du Trocadéro, where you can admire the famed view of Palais de Chaillot and the Eiffel Tower across the Seine.
20 minutes here
Cross the Pont d'Iéna bridge and cycle underneath the Eiffel Tower to fully appreciate its grand scale and iconic beauty.
25 minutes here
Follow your guide through the quiet green landscape of Champ de Mars to the magnificent military museum complex Les Invalides and St Louis des Invalides Cathedral, where notable French officers like Napoleon are buried.
25 minutes here
The Seine
Enjoy the charming atmosphere of busy Parisian streets lined with elegant old tenement houses. Cycle along the romantic Seine River and see the golden replica of Lady Liberty’s torch, Flame of Liberty.
25 minutes here
Arc de Triomphe
Highlight of this exciting tour will be the iconic Arc de Triomphe, which commemorates Napoleon’s victories.
25 minutes here
The alternative, longer route includes cycling from Les Invalides to the other side of Seine to admire the statue-studded 17th century Tuileries Garden.
25 minutes here
Louvre Museum
Arc de Triomphe du Carrousel and the Louvre Palace with its iconic glass Pyramid.
25 minutes here
Rue De Rivoli
Further along you will see the amazing gilded bronze equestrian statue of Joan of Arc on the charming Rue de Rivoli.
25 minutes here
Palais Garnier
Other points of interest will be the stunning Italian-style opera house Palais Garnier, the Madeleine Church, and the Place de la Concorde featuring the iconic Ancient Egyptian Luxor Obelisk, Fontaine des Fleuves and Fontaine des Mers.
50 minutes here
Grand Palais
The route will continue by art nouveau Grand Palais and end by the monolithic Arc de Triomphe.
25 minutes here
The extended route includes cycling from Les Invalides to the beautiful green spaces of the Luxembourg Gardens with the magnificent Luxembourg Palace, which now houses the French Senate.
25 minutes here
Notre-Dame
Another sight along the way will be the 18th century mausoleum Panthéon, where many notable French citizens are buried. Cycle through the “birthplace of Paris”, Ile de la Cité to marvel at the Gothic masterpiece Notre Dame Cathedral.
25 minutes here
See also the beautiful city hall Hôtel de Ville, Saint Jacques Tower, and continue past the Louvre. There will also be some free time to grab a croissant or other local snack to fuel up your energy.
25 minutes here

When is the best time to visit Paris?
+
April to June and September to October, when queues thin out and terraces stay open late. Booking patterns follow the same curve: prices and queues climb in peak weeks, while shoulder season gives you better availability on the top-ranked experiences and more room to change plans.
How many days do you need in Paris?
+
Three full days covers the headline sights without sprinting. A workable rhythm is one anchor experience each morning, such as this one, an unhurried afternoon in a single neighborhood, then a food or nightlife booking in the evening. Five days lets you add a day trip outside the city.
